По какому принципу функционируют платформы логирования
Системы логирования — это механизмы, которые записывают операции, возникающие внутри сервисов, серверных узлов, баз информации, инфраструктурных компонентов и прочих элементов IT-инфраструктуры. Любое операция платформы способно быть сохранено в качестве отдельной сообщения: активация процесса, проведение обращения, ошибка сервиса, операция авторизации, соединение к базе информации, смена конфигурации или отказ стороннего вавада казино компонента.
Запись логов позволяет не только накапливать технические данные, а восстанавливать подробную картину функционирования программного решения. В ресурсах формата вавада казино эти платформы часто оцениваются как база анализа, контроля устойчивости и анализа неполадок, потому что без логов IT команда замечает только итоговую проблему, но не отслеживает цепочку, который к ней приводит.
Что собой представляет такое журнал
Лог — является запись о операции, которое произошло в системе. Чаще всего она содержит время действия, отправителя, уровень значимости, пояснение и дополнительные сведения. Например, приложение может записать, что обращение успешно выполнен, объект не найден, соединение с базой информации прервано или клиентская vavada casino активность прервалась по превышению времени.
Эта запись способна оставаться просто, но данное практическая ценность крайне значимо. Если платформа стал функционировать нестабильно или с перебоями, именно журналы помогают понять, что случалось до сбоя. Журналы показывают последовательность действий, позволяют обнаружить регулярные ошибки и предоставляют IT сотрудникам факты вместо гипотез.
Записи особенно важны в многоуровневых платформах, где конкретный запрос обрабатывается через несколько компонентов. Ошибка будет возникнуть не в центральном модуле, а в хранилище данных, очереди операций, компоненте доступа, стороннем API или сетевом подключении. При отсутствии логов анализ основания оказывается намного дольше вавада.
Почему требуются инструменты логирования
Ключевая цель инструмента ведения логов — накапливать, удерживать и организовывать сообщения о состоянии IT-среды. Если отдельный модуль формирует записи самостоятельно и эти записи лежат на разных серверах, разбор становится неудобным. При инциденте нужно отдельно подключаться в разные системы, искать нужные записи и связывать события по датам.
Общая среда ведения логов решает данную сложность. Платформа собирает сообщения из многих компонентов в едином хранилище, систематизирует записи, позволяет проводить выборку, строить условия, отслеживать сбои и сразу вавада казино получать нужные записи. В результате этому диагностика отнимает меньшее количество времени, а работа с инцидентами делается более контролируемой.
Журналирование также дает возможность измерять уровень функционирования платформы. По записям легко обнаружить, какие сбои фиксируются регулярно чаще прочих, какие операции отнимают слишком избыточно периода, какие внешние сервисы действуют неустойчиво и какие части системы нуждаются в доработки.
Какие основные действия регистрируются в журналах
Платформа может записывать различные типы действий. На слое приложения это приходящие обращения, реакции сервера, сбои исполнения, действия программных частей, запуск фоновых процессов, выполнение данных и связь vavada casino с другими сервисами.
На стороне инфраструктуры в записи записываются сообщения серверной среды, сетевые сессии, повторные запуски служб, ошибки накопителей, корректировки прав доступа, состояние процессов и уведомления от внутренних компонентов.
Особую группу составляют сигналы защиты. К таким событиям принадлежат успешные и проваленные действия входа, обновление учетных данных, смена прав, аномальные действия, запросы к ограниченным ресурсам, нестандартная деятельность служебных записей и другие действия, которые способны указывать вавада на угрозу.
Из каких элементов состоит сообщение лога
Полезная строка журнала обязана быть понятной и информативной. В строке обязательно фиксируется временная отметка. Она показывает, когда точно случилось операция. Для многоузловых платформ это особенно существенно, потому что отдельный процесс может обрабатываться через несколько узлов и сервисов.
Второй важный компонент — отправитель сообщения. Им способно быть идентификатор приложения, сервиса, контейнерного узла, хоста, части или процесса. Компонент позволяет понять, из какого компонента возникла строка и какая часть платформы запрашивает внимания.
Еще один элемент — уровень значимости. Как правило используются категории debug, info, warning, error и critical. Они дают возможность отделить типовые текущие события от сигналов, которые нуждаются в диагностики или срочной вавада казино ответной меры.
- Debug — развернутая системная сведения для разработки и детальной отладки;
- Info — обычные сообщения, отражающие нормальную работу платформы;
- Warning-уровень — сигналы о возможных проблемах;
- Error — ошибки, которые останавливают обработку конкретной процедуры;
- Critical — серьезные сбои, воздействующие на доступность или информационную безопасность платформы.
Также в логах способны сохраняться идентификаторы операций, номера сбоев, IP-идентификаторы, названия операций, результаты процессов, время обработки, настройки контекста и иные сведения. Чем точнее сохранен контекст, тем проще выявить источник ошибки.
Каким образом накапливаются логи
Накопление журналов начинается внутри сервиса или инфраструктурного компонента. Сервис фиксирует операцию в журнал, обычный vavada casino вывод вывода, местное место хранения или отдельный сборщик. После записи лог может оставаться на хосте или направляться в единую среду.
В нынешних инфраструктурах часто применяется агент получения логов. Такой агент размещается на узел или работает рядом с приложением, получает свежие сообщения и отправляет логи в систему накопления. Этот подход удобен, потому что программы не обязаны отдельно учитывать, куда точно передавать данные.
В контейнерных средах записи обычно забираются из выводов stdout и stderr. Изолированная среда выводит сообщения во внешний вывод, а платформа или модуль забирает записи и передает вавада в хранилище. Это облегчает обслуживание с гибкой системой, где изолированные среды способны быстро формироваться, останавливаться и переноситься между серверами.
Общее накопление логов
Если логи накапливаются из нескольких компонентов, их нужно сохранять в едином пространстве. Централизованное хранилище дает возможность сразу выполнять анализ, сортировать строки, группировать записи, строить сводки и проверять работу целой инфраструктуры, а не отдельного сервера.
В процессе сохранением логи часто получают преобразование. Инструмент может определять поля, преобразовывать формат времени, добавлять метки контекста, устанавливать источник, удалять лишние вавада казино поля и приводить логи к стандартной форме. Это особенно значимо, если несколько программы пишут записи в разном шаблоне.
Система хранения записей должно принимать крупный массив данных. Нагруженные платформы могут формировать множество и огромные массивы сообщений в рабочий период. Поэтому системы ведения логов задействуют индексацию, сжатие, условия хранения и механизмы очистки давних данных.
Выборка и сортировка логов
Одна из из главных возможностей инструмента логирования — оперативный поиск. При анализе сбоя необходимо обнаружить сообщения за определенный интервал даты, по нужному сервису, номеру сбоя, идентификатору операции или степени значимости.
Фильтрация дает возможность исключить ненужный массив. К примеру, можно оставить только неполадки определенного приложения за предыдущие 30 vavada casino мин. или выявить все события, соотнесенные с отдельным вызовом. Это значительно облегчает диагностику, потому что специалист имеет дело не со всем массивом логов, а с нужной долей информации.
Поиск по записям особенно полезен при плавающих сбоях. Если ошибка возникает не постоянно, а только при заданных сценариях, логи помогают выявить закономерность: отдельный тип операции, заданное окно, отдельный хост, подключенный ресурс или нестандартный комплект данных.
Записи и анализ ошибок
При сбое журналы позволяют ответить на ряд важных моментов. В какой момент возникла неполадка, какой компонент первым уведомил об ошибке, какие операции проводились перед сбоем, какие сервисы использовались в операции и фиксировалась ли подобная проблема вавада раньше.
К примеру, сервис будет показать неполадку проведения операции. В логах заметно, что перед этим модуль передал запрос к системе информации, зафиксировал превышение времени, повторил операцию и закончил процесс с ошибкой. Подобная последовательность сразу сужает зону поиска и показывает, что ошибка может быть ассоциирована не с интерфейсом, а с хранилищем информации или канальным соединением.
Без журналов нужно было бы бы изучать любой модуль по отдельности. С журналами разбор делается логичным. Вначале проверяется период ошибки, затем компонент, затем соотнесенные сообщения и только после данного этапа формируется техническая предположение вавада казино.
Логирование и наблюдение
Логирование напрямую связано с наблюдением, но они не одно и то же. Мониторинг показывает статус системы через метрики: использование на процессор, время ответа, число ошибок, работоспособность сервиса, количество RAM и прочие измеримые значения.
Записи раскрывают подробности. Если контроль отображает рост неполадок, запись логов дает возможность определить, какие именно неполадки зафиксировались, в каком компоненте, при каких параметрах и с какими параметрами. Поэтому эти инструменты чаще обычно применяются совместно.
Измерения дают возможность увидеть проблему, а логи позволяют установить данную причину. Такое сочетание обеспечивает диагностику vavada casino скорее и точнее, особенно в платформах с значительным числом сервисов и связей.
Запись логов и защита
Системы логирования занимают значимую функцию в системной защите. Платформы фиксируют операции учетных записей, администраторов, программ и внешних ресурсов. Это дает возможность выявлять подозрительную поведенческую картину и проводить вавада аудит.
К значимым записям защиты относятся проваленные операции доступа, частые вызовы, корректировка разрешений доступа, обращение к ограниченным данным, старт подозрительных операций и нетипичные соединения. Если подобные события оцениваются постоянно, опасность пропустить опасность оказывается ниже.
При такой схеме журналы должны сохраняться защищенно. В логах не нужно записывать коды доступа, развернутые идентификаторы документов, платежные данные, токены авторизации и другие критичные данные. Если эта деталь попадает в лог, она способна повысить дополнительный риск.
Упорядоченные и неформализованные логи
Обычный лог-файл смотрится как обычная описательная сообщение. Такой лог будет казаться прост для чтения инженером, но сложнее анализируется автоматически. К примеру, если сообщение создано свободным текстом, системе менее удобно определить из текста номер сбоя, идентификатор запроса или имя компонента.
Структурированный журнал фиксирует данные в понятном формате, например JSON. В подобной записи любое сведение находится в самостоятельном разделе: дата, важность, компонент, описание, код ошибки, ID запроса и служебные параметры.
Структурированный подход практичнее для выборки, фильтрации и оценки. Он помогает сразу выбирать релевантные поля, формировать сводки и сопоставлять сообщения между собою. Поэтому в актуальных системах формализованные логи задействуются все чаще.